.cgv2-wrapper{position:relative;width:100%;margin:30px 0;padding:35px 20px;background:linear-gradient(145deg,#0f0518 0%,#1a082b 100%);border:1px solid rgba(170,50,255,.4);border-radius:20px;overflow:hidden;box-sizing:border-box;box-shadow:0 15px 35px rgba(0,0,0,.6),0 0 25px rgba(138,43,226,.2),inset 0 0 30px rgba(138,43,226,.1);transition:transform .4s ease,box-shadow .4s ease;z-index:10}.cgv2-wrapper:hover{transform:translateY(-3px);box-shadow:0 20px 40px rgba(0,0,0,.7),0 0 35px rgba(138,43,226,.4),inset 0 0 40px rgba(138,43,226,.2);border:1px solid rgba(170,50,255,.8)}.cgv2-inner-content{position:relative;z-index:20;text-align:center;font-family:inherit;line-height:1.8}.cgv2-title{font-size:22px;font-weight:800;margin-bottom:15px;display:inline-block;padding-bottom:10px;border-bottom:2px solid rgba(255,255,255,.1);letter-spacing:1px}.cgv2-text{font-size:16px;font-weight:600}.cgv2-text p{margin:0;padding:0}#cgv2-stars-container{position:absolute;top:0;left:0;width:100%;height:100%;z-index:1;pointer-events:none;overflow:hidden}.cgv2-star{position:absolute;border-radius:50%;opacity:0;animation:cgv2_float_animation linear infinite}@keyframes cgv2_float_animation{0%{transform:translateY(100px) scale(.5);opacity:0}20%{opacity:.8}80%{opacity:.8}100%{transform:translateY(-50px) scale(1.5);opacity:0}}